Casuarina vs Bogangar.
Comparing two suburbs with median house prices of $2,200,000 and $1,555,000.
Bogangar (median $1,555,000) is roughly 41% cheaper to buy into than Casuarina ($2,200,000). Over the past year, Casuarina (+8.6%) ran 4.6 percentage points ahead of Bogangar (+4%) on house-price growth.
Casuarina scores higher on walkability (32/100 vs 0/100 ), useful if you're optimising for a car-light household. On school quality, the average ICSEA across schools serving Bogangar (1041) sits above Casuarina (1024). Casuarina skews owner-occupied (77%), Bogangar runs more rental-dense (66% owner).

Does Casuarina or Bogangar have better schools?
On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Bogangar scores 1041 vs 1024 in Casuarina.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
Which is more walkable, Casuarina or Bogangar?
Casuarina scores 32/100 on walkability vs 0/100. Above 70 is considered very walkable (most errands on foot), 50-69 is walkable for some errands, below 50 typically requires a car for daily life.
Which suburb has higher rental yield, Casuarina or Bogangar?
Gross rental yield on houses is 3.30% in Casuarina vs 2.93% in Bogangar. Gross yield equals annual rent divided by purchase price. Net yield (after strata, rates, insurance, agent fees and maintenance) typically runs 1.5-2 percentage points lower.
